Reading some of the critic's reviews, this seems to be one of those "love it or hate it" movies. Having read some of the more scathing comments, I think it is fair to say thay some of these critics must have missed the fact, clearly laid out at the beginning AND the end that this movie is based on a true story! There is a certain restriction when you try to portay an actual event, you are stuck with a certain reality and it may not make the most wild action triller. If you try to alter it to fit a more acceptable Hollywood format, well, then its no longer "based on a true story" is it.
Roger Ebert got it right I think, he gave it a "B" so do I. He wrote "This movie by its nature is not thrilling, but it is very genuinely interesting, and that is rare." I think that's a great thing to say about a movie, especially this one. There are some really great roles in this film and one is Vin Diesel's portrayal of the mobster "Jackie D." Vin will never win an Oscar but I think this movie will remain as one of his very best acting performances. This part is simply tailor-made for him, it fits him like a glove. Vin usually plays more or less a caricature of a real person and so is the mobster "Jackie D" so it works very well. Peter Dinklage is simply excellent as the chief defence attorny and Ron Silver gives one of his best and strongest performances as the judge.
